Theyll give your presentations a professional, memorable appearance the kind of sophisticated look that. If you change the class models, nosql databases will let you store the new data without needing to change your entire database model. It may be look like a weird concept, if you are from traditional sql background where you need to create a database, table and insert values in the table manually. Codd at ibm in the late 1960s who was looking for ways to solve the problems with the existing models. Ndbms will be a codasyl type database as opposed to a relational database. Winner of the standing ovation award for best powerpoint templates from presentations magazine. The relational model developed out of the work done by dr.
Defining a database specifying the data types, structures, and constraints of the data to be stored uses a data definition language metadata database definition or descriptive information stored by the dbms in the form of a database catalog or data dictionary phases for designing a database. Learn key details for performing data preparation, exploration, and extraction for each type of nosql database. For example show me the docids of the name and last name fields that are blank. A mandatory column requires you to insert or update a not null constrained column with a real value the cardinality of all. After all, a databases usefulness is directly proportional to the sleekness and efficiency of its design. In the world of database queries, any time a select query is run, it temporarily locks the corresponding tables by default. Each column, or attribute, in the file corresponds to a particular set and all of the values from a particular column come from the same domain, or set. She has worked with aws athena, aurora, redshift, kinesis, and. While designing a database, it is very important to design it correctly. Ramon lawrence, university of british columbia okanagan this course surveys a variety of nosql databases and systems including mapreduce, apache pig, apache hadoop, mongodb, dynamodb, redis, neo4j and others.
In order to start integration, you need to install additional piece of software on report server itself and configure it for sharepoint integration. Ms access 2 report optional information from the database is organized in a nice presentation that can be printed in an access report. Our new crystalgraphics chart and diagram slides for powerpoint is a collection of over impressively designed datadriven chart and editable diagram s guaranteed to impress any audience. When you connect to the database using management studio make sure you can execute sprocs, select and update from tables, etc. This tutorial explains the basics of dbms such as its architecture, data models, data schemas, data independence, er model, relation model, relational database design, and storage and file structure and much more. Nosql data stores documentations,tutorials and lecture. How can a query database to show me the fields that are blank.
Dbms allows its users to create their own databases as per their requirement. Sql overview sql is a programming language for relational databases. Likewise, it is important that you have a feel for good database design. Dbms allows its users to create their own databases which are relevant with the nature of work they want. The same example using xml configuration, we have developed in the previous tutorial hibernate crud using xml configuration. Motivations for this approach include simplicity of design, horizontal scaling, and finer control over availability. The slowness in the response time is usually due to the records being stored randomly in database tables. Understanding graph databases for our graph database explanations, we will rely on material from neo4j, likely the mostused graph database implementation of them all. However, many popular database products such as sql database management systems dbms can only store and manipulate scalar values such as integers and strings organized within tables. Any arithmetic operation with null columns will result in null values. A smallest mistake done at the design stage spoils the whole design, code and efficiency of the database. Find the name of customers who live in the same zip code area as wayne dick. These databases are good for smaller data storage requirements, but you need big data capabilities to manage large queries. Sql is a database computer language designed for the retrieval and management of data in a relational database.
A not null constraint prevents the insertion of any null value in a column. Integrating ssrs with sharepoint ssrs reports can be integrated with sharepoint services as well as office sharepoint server. If it asks you to create a diagram say yes, then add the tables. Create a website sql data warehousing css php html database normalization. The programmer must either convert the object values into groups of simpler values for storage in the database and convert them back upon retrieval, or only. Codd and these databases answered the question of having no standard way to store data. The business data file resembles a relation in a number of ways. Native and transparent because it directly persists objects the way they. Worlds best powerpoint templates crystalgraphics offers more powerpoint templates than anyone else in the world, with over 4 million to choose from. Some of these options are common across all database management systems. Hadoop nosql database tutorial online, hadoop nosql training.
A network database is a type of database model wherein multiple member records or files can be linked to multiple owner files and vice versa. A nosql database organizes large distributed data sets into tuples key value pairs and objects. The present tutorial is for hibernate 4 example with annotation based configuration using maven. Actually, thats fine if you have a genuinely keyvalue. Query a lotus notes database solutions experts exchange. Most of the time a regular subquery will do what you need, but correlated subqueries can be handy, too. A database is a separate application that stores a collection of data. When these classes store data, they represent a document and store in the database dynamically. Optimizing your database is a cheaper and better solution. Download network database management system for free.
They are also known as nosql databases and are growing in popularity as a result of the rise of big data and the need to handle the great volumes, variety, and velocity of data. Nosql is a nonrelational database management systems, different from traditional relational database management systems in some significant ways. Sql was developed by ibm in 1970s and has its roots in the relational algebra defined by codd in 1972. All aggregate functions, except count ignores the null values. Tables, queries, forms, reports, macros, modules, open, design, new. A database that can be modelled through any other means apart from the traditional tabular relations is generally referred to as a nosql database. Now, for those interested in pursuing some practical experience with widelyused nosql implementations, the following is a select list of tutorials for working with the database engines appearing in the previously referenced top nosql database engines post, using python. Optimizing database pagination using couchbase n1ql. Database management system or dbms in short refers to the technology of storing and retrieving usersi data with utmost efficiency along with appropriate security measures. Null values in dbms null values in sql tutorialcup. Nov 01, 2016 while designing a database, it is very important to design it correctly. This tutorial explains the basics of dbms such as its architecture, data models, data schemas, data independence, er model, relation model, relational database design, and. Using in with subqueries to filter data querying relational.
Database management system dbms tutorial database management system or dbms in short, refers to the technology of storing and retriving users data with utmost efficiency along with safety and security features. Sql is an ansi american national standards institute standard, but there are many different versions of the. To avoid impedance mismatch overhead between object and relational worlds, give a try to ndatabase. In order to process and execute this request, dbms has to convert it into low level machine understandable language. Database management system tutorial tutorialspoint. Database systems are designed to manage large bodies of information. A common use of subqueries is to perform tests for set membership, make set comparisons, and determine set car dinality. A not null constraint changes the default optional nature of the column to a mandatory criteria. Hadoop nosql database tutorial online, hadoop nosql.
Architecture access calls anything that can have a name an object. It is designed over relational algebra and tuple relational calculus. Do i need to write an agent for it or is there an easy way similar to access query builder. A database management system dbms, is a software program that enables the creation and management of databases. A not null at database tutorial michael mclaughlin. Database index in dbmstutorial,database index types database index interview questions database index performance database index tutorial indices in database what is the purpose of indexes in database why indexing is required in database indexes in rdbms. Generally, these databases will be more complex than the text filespreadsheet example in the previous lesson. These databases are highly configurable and offer a bunch of options. The database vendor or open source project provides a rest api and some libraries that let you put data in and pull that same data out. For database write actions, onbase executables need to lock tables to perform tasks such as assigning a unique document id to a new document, storing index values. If not, right on database diagrams folder and create new diagram.
Relational databases use primary and foreign keys and have strict constraints when you manipulate the tables data. Each database has one or more distinct apis for creating, accessing, managing, searching and replicating the data it holds. Pdf version quick guide resources job search discussion. Chart and diagram slides for powerpoint beautifully designed chart and diagram s for powerpoint with visually stunning graphics and animation effects.
Sql is an ansi american national standards institute standard language, but there are many different versions of the sql language. Database design is like a foundation for a good database. In this case, youll have to find the required information with a subquery. Nosql, known as not only sql database, provides a mechanism for storage and retrieval of data and is the next generation database. Your contribution will go a long way in helping us. Sql is a language of database, it includes database creation, deletion, fetching rows and modifying rows etc. Review case studies that show how to use various nosql databases with popular data science tools, including the document database mongodb, the widecolumn database cassandra, and the graph database neo4j. A poor database design creates unwanted data in a table called data redundancy. It has a distributed architecture with mongodb and is open source. But later relational database also get a problem that it could not handle big data, due to this problem there was a need of database which can handle every types of problems then nosql database was developed. Object because the basic persistent unit is an object, not a table. The user typically writes his requests in sql language. Top 50 aws interview questions and answers for 2018 recap of hadoop news for february 2018 recap of apache spark news for june 2017 recap of hadoop news for april 2017. Nonrelational databases are any type of database that does not follow the relational database model.
Sometimes you dont have enough information available when you design a query to determine which rows you want. Nov 01, 2016 database index in dbmstutorial, database index types database index interview questions database index performance database index tutorial indices in database what is the purpose of indexes in database why indexing is required in database indexes in rdbms. Management of data involves both defining structures for storage of information and providing mechanisms for the manipulation of information. Sql is an acronym for structured query language and is a standard relational query language sql has been standardized by both ansi and iso used for interaction with databases. Expand the root database, try and expand the database diagrams folder, it should say something like no diagrams. It scans and parses the query into individual tokens. How to see table relationships in database diagrams.
Ppt nosql powerpoint presentation free to download. Consider the below example where one of the student has not yet received his average mark. Most of the nosql are open source and it has a capability of horizontal scalability which means that commodity kind. Mar 24, 2020 optimizing your database is a cheaper and better solution. Justin, make sure the db user is an owner of the database. Good database design it is most likely that as a web developer, you will be working with one of the modern relational databases and that you will be able to work in conjunction with an existing database administrator. Search queries have to loop through the entire randomly stored records one after the other to locate the desired data. Any query issued to the database is first picked by query processor. A nosql often interpreted as not only sql database provides a mechanism for storage and retrieval of data that is modeled in means other than the tabular relations used in relational databases.
This course does not cover the concept called correlated subqueries, which are slightly different in how they tie in with the outer query. Aws vs azurewho is the big winner in the cloud war. Qxorm is developed by lionel marty, a software development engineer since 2003. Actually, mongodb do not provide any command to create database. Other kinds of data stores can also be used, such as files on the file system or large hash tables in memory but data fetching and writing would not be. Nosql lets you create database tables using your oo classes. About the tutorial database management system or dbms in short refers to the technology of storing and retrieving users data with utmost efficiency along with appropriate security measures. Of course in the 80s the relational database model became the rage. Microsoft access is a database management system dbms from microsoft that combines the relational microsoft jet database engine with a graphical user. And your ability to take advantage of a database is directly proportional to your. Database administrators stack exchange is a question and answer site for database professionals who wish to improve their database skills and learn from others in the community. In this tutorials, we are going to implement a complete crud application using hibernate annotations and mysql.
In addition, the database system must ensure the safety of the information stored, despite system crashes or attempts at unauthorized access. Ppt nosql powerpoint presentation free to download id. Sql tutorial sql is a database computer language designed for the retrieval and management of data in a relational database. This tutorial will especially help computer science graduates in understanding the basictoadvanced concepts related to database management systems.
276 1246 1176 1345 209 106 1084 1336 1459 1669 667 89 1465 512 1414 195 358 1067 1403 535 1634 553 320 820 236 1193 1246 272 1101 624